STATE v. PROPHET

No. 12-1389.

762 S.E.2d 602 (2014)

STATE of West Virginia, Plaintiff Below, Respondent v. Antonio PROPHET, Defendant Below, Petitioner.

Supreme Court of Appeals of West Virginia.

Decided June 5, 2014.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Christopher J. Prezioso, Esq. , Luttrell & Prezioso, PLLC, Charles Town, WV, for Petitioner.

Cheryl K. Saville, Esq. , Assistant Prosecuting Attorney, Martinsburg, WV, for Respondent.


PER CURIAM:

Petitioner Antonio Prophet appeals his convictions in the Circuit Court of Berkeley County of two counts of first-degree murder, both without a recommendation of mercy, and one count of arson. For the reasons set forth below, we affirm the petitioner's convictions.
